[Concept,1/2] Revert "sandbox: Avoid mon_len being larger than available RAM"
Commit Message
From: Simon Glass <sjg@chromium.org>
This fix turns out to be insufficient in the corner case where mon_len
is smaller than available, emulated RAM but large enough that there
isn't enough left.
This reverts commit 88b810e241e7d1ccdf1d7329339cf5d5d9cef474.
Signed-off-by: Simon Glass <sjg@chromium.org>
---
common/board_f.c | 6 +-----
1 file changed, 1 insertion(+), 5 deletions(-)
@@ -464,11 +464,7 @@ static int reserve_uboot(void)
* reserve memory for U-Boot code, data & bss
* round down to next 4 kB limit
*/
- if (IS_ENABLED(CONFIG_SANDBOX) && gd->mon_len > gd->relocaddr)
- log_debug("Cannot reserve space for U-Boot\n");
- else
- gd->relocaddr -= gd->mon_len;
-
+ gd->relocaddr -= gd->mon_len;
gd->relocaddr &= ~(4096 - 1);
#if defined(CONFIG_E500) || defined(CONFIG_MIPS)
/* round down to next 64 kB limit so that IVPR stays aligned */